DNV is presenting this 3 day workshop on engineering reliable structures for wind and solar industry, which is developed in-house and drawing on our extensive global expertise - helping you turn our knowledge into your power.

The lessons and recommendations are based on DNV’s global experience of wind and solar projects in the areas of product and project technical due diligence, owners engineering, as well as the review of operational project performance (including forensic reviews). 

WTG Foundation Design and Monitoring (1st and 2nd day)
A 2-day in-depth course for industry professionals willing to gain greater understanding of the considerations necessary in WTG foundation design and construction with a holistic view on associated risks, life extension and structural health monitoring.

Solar PV Module mounting structure design (3rd day) 
This 1-day workshop specially prepared for industry leaders committed towards minimizing the numerous failures plaguing the Indian Solar industry.
